Sheron Unveils Confidence‑Boosting Song & Video ‘Gurri (You Know You Should)’

Catchy Chords and Cartoon Capers: Sheron Unveils the Anthem Your Confidence Needs with New Single and Video ‘Gurri (You Know You Should)’

Ever found yourself in a situation where your inner critic simply won’t stop? Meet its match in Sheron’s new song and video, ‘Gurri (You Know You Should)’. It’s an alt-rock confidence booster wrapped in an irresistible guitar riff and chorus – part anthem, part animated pep talk, equal measures grit and grin.

 

Building on the warm reception of his debut solo album, ‘Goodbye My Love’ (released on 28 March), Sheron invites listeners into the richly melodic world of ‘Gurri’, his wild, cartoon alter ego. Think of it as a tag-team match between “Sheron, the Doubter” and “Sheron, the You-Gotta-Believe-In-Yourself Machine”.

 

This alt-rock earworm weaves memorable guitar hooks with a driving rhythm, marrying introspective lyrics to an infectious chorus. The result is a song that’s as catchy as it is compelling – an anthem for anyone who’s ever felt the tug of self-doubt.

 

‘Gurri’ explores social anxiety through a clever dual narrative: live-action sequences show Sheron in vulnerable, real-world moments, while a vibrant caricature alter ego taunts him with the confidence he craves. As the melodic guitar line unfurls and the chorus soars, that inner voice – sharp, self-aware and insistent – urges you to step up and own your story.

 

We’ve all had that moment when fear renders us mute, so let the melody lift you, let the lyrics propel you, and let your inner voice grow loud and colourful.

Sheron (born Sharon Sibert) brings over three decades of musical mastery to the track. A consummate multi‑instrumentalist – vocals, guitar, bass, drums and keys – he’s lent his talents to Watershed and Amersham, and shared stages with luminaries such as Dr Victor and Dilana. His rich experience infuses every note of ‘Gurri’ with authenticity and heart.

 

Sheron adds that “I wanted to capture that universal tug‑of‑war between hesitation and boldness. The melody had to be uplifting and infectious, but the lyrics needed to tell the story of our inner dialogue. Bringing the caricature alter ego into the video was the perfect way to give that inner voice a face – and to remind us of all that sometimes we need to listen to ourselves.”

Sheron Bio

 

Sheron, real name Sharon Sibert, is a musician, producer, and sound engineer with over 30 years of professional experience in the music industry. His career took off as a key member of the band X-Over (1996 – 2004), touring extensively across South Africa, Namibia, Botswana, Hong Kong, and China. Known for his mastery of multiple instruments – including vocals, guitar, bass, drums, and keys – Sheron has played thousands of gigs and contributed to numerous musical projects like Watershed and Amersham.

His solo career has seen chart success, with his singles ‘Hello, It’s Us’, ‘I Know’, ‘Glow’, and ‘Need You’, reaching top positions on local radio. Sheron has collaborated with renowned artists such as Dr. Victor, and Dilana, and has had the honour of performing for South African President Cyril Ramaphosa. In addition to his performing career, Sheron’s expertise extends to music production and sound engineering, where he has contributed to major festivals and venues, including The Barnyard Theatre, AARDKLOP, and the KKNK festivals.

 

From high-profile corporate events for brands like Pick n Pay, Telkom, and Edcon, to prestigious casino residencies at Sun City, Montecasino, and The Carousel Casino, to international performances at the Australian Embassy in Beijing, Sheron continues to push creative boundaries and captivate audiences worldwide.
